STATEMENT
BACKGROUND
[7] ASPENFUN (hereinafter “the complainant”), a Ridgeway Department of Transportation (RDOT) tow
operator, as well as a Ridgeway County Sheriff’s Office (RCSO) Deputy and a Ridgeway State Police (RSP) Trooper,
were shot and killed by CERTDOM and NOAHBADNOLIE on July 11th, 2026, near the Sterling Heights gas station.
[8] The complainant respawned at the RDOT headquarters located in Palmer, where he was again shot and
killed by DPSBADATJOB while the complainant was taking his lawful firearm from his van.
[9] Following this, DPSBADATJOB destroyed the van and its contents owned by the complainant by shooting
and setting the vehicle on fire.
[10] The complainant submitted a criminal tip to the CID on July 11th, 2026, along with a video clip displaying
the incident.
FIRST INCIDENT
[11] In the video evidence submitted by the complainant, the complainant is driving an RDOT Highline Flatbed
as part of his duties as a tow operator when suspects CERTDOM and NOAHBADNOLIE maneuver and stop in front
of the truck in their blue Actila Sport at the intersection by Sterling gas station.
[12] Following this, the suspects exit their vehicle, draw their firearms, aim, and open fire at the complainant as
well as RCSO Deputy HxgoNix riding as a passenger in the Highline Flatbed. RSP Trooper Rar3Bitcoin, who was
operating a marked RSP Pioneer, was behind the truck and was also fired upon by the suspects during the
shooting.
[13] The complainant and the Deputy are immediately struck and killed by the gunfire. The State Trooper
manages to return fire and kill CERTDOM, but is killed immediately after by gunfire from NOAHBADNOLIE.
[14] The complainant was a uniformed RDOT operator driving a marked RDOT tow truck. The Deputy and State
Trooper were clearly identifiable as peace officers by their uniforms and the marked patrol vehicle the Trooper was
driving. They were on duty and patrolling, clearly conducting lawful duties when the incident took place.
[15] Based on my experience and training as a law enforcement officer, I can identify the firearms used by the
suspects to carry out the shooting as Stetson Cardiac-5s. The Cardiac-5 is an automatic submachine gun, requiring
an Advanced Firearms License to possess. The State Police have not licensed the suspects, and they are therefore
not legally allowed to possess such firearms. This can be referenced by viewing the State Police database.

[16] As the complainant respawned at the RDOT headquarters in Palmer, he proceeded to spawn his personal
blue Gridlock bearing plate ABO944 in the headquarters’ garage. The complainant equipped himself with a
Cardiac-5. The complainant is a current holder of an Advanced Firearms License. This can be referenced by viewing
the State Police database.
[17] Following this, the complainant proceeded to despawn the blue Gridlock in order to spawn a red Gridlock
bearing plate COR132, where he stored the .45 ACP ammunition for the firearm. As the complainant opened the
trunk of the van, DPSBADATJOB forcibly entered the garage and immediately opened fire at the complainant, killing
him.
[18] After killing the complainant, DPSBADATJOB proceeded to direct automatic gunfire at the red Gridlock
owned by the complainant. As a result of the shooting, the vehicle was set on fire and destroyed with the contents
therein.
[19] DPSBADATJOB was using a Cardiac-5, which I can identify based on its unique shape, color, size, and
gunfire, to kill the complainant and destroy his vehicle. DPSBADATJOB is not a holder of an Advanced Firearms
License and is not lawfully permitted to possess an automatic firearm. This can be referenced by viewing the State
Police database.
[20] The RDOT headquarters is not accessible by civilians (except the lobby). The doors therein can only be
opened by persons holding correct permissions, mainly government employees. As such, DPSBADATJOB had to
use a lockpick to break and enter the building unlawfully. The garage of the headquarters cannot be accessed by
any other methods.
[21] It can also be seen at 00:53 in Exhibit A that DPSBADATJOB is holding a lockpick, actively lockpicking the
door to exit the headquarters.
